' Name : VMETERX.pbp ' Compiler : PICBASIC PRO Compiler 2.6 ' Assembler : PM or MPASM ' Target PIC : 40-pin 16F877 or similar ' Hardware : LAB-X1 Experimenter Board ' Oscillator : 4MHz external ' Keywords : ADCIN, LCDOUT ' Description : PICBASIC PRO program to measure voltage (0-5VDC) ' and display on LCD with 2 decimal places. ' ' This program uses the */ operator to scale the ADC result from 0-1023 ' to 0-500. The */ performs a divide by 256 automatically, allowing math ' which would normally exceed the limit of a word variable. ' Connect analog input to channel-0 (RA0) ' Define LOADER_USED to allow use of the boot loader. ' This will not affect normal program operation. Define LOADER_USED 1 ' Define LCD registers and bits Define LCD_DREG PORTD Define LCD_DBIT 4 Define LCD_RSREG PORTE Define LCD_RSBIT 0 Define LCD_EREG PORTE Define LCD_EBIT 1 ' Define ADCIN parameters Define ADC_BITS 10 ' Set number of bits in result Define ADC_CLOCK 3 ' Set clock source (3=rc) Define ADC_SAMPLEUS 50 ' Set sampling time in uS adval Var Word ' Create adval to store result TRISA = %11111111 ' Set PORTA to all input ADCON1 = %10000010 ' Set PORTA analog and right justify result Low PORTE.2 ' LCD R/W line low (W) Pause 500 ' Wait .5 second mainloop: Adcin 0, adval ' Read channel 0 to adval (0-1023) adval = (adval */ 500)>>2 ' Equates to: (adval * 500)/1024 LCDOut $fe, 1 ' Clear LCD LCDOut "DC Volts= ",DEC (adval/100),".", DEC2 adval ' Display the decimal value Pause 100 ' Wait .1 second Goto mainloop ' Do it forever End
